Jhené Aiko’s ALLEL x Awe Inspired jewelry blends mysticism and nature

Jhené Aiko’s ALLEL x Awe Inspired capsule feels less like celebrity merchandise and more like a set of wearable talismans, built around aquamarine, Califia symbolism, and a distinctly Californian sense of ease. The most striking detail is the meaning behind it all: ALLEL stands for “a living light, eternal love,” which gives the collaboration a private, intimate quality that makes it easy to picture as a gift with real emotional weight.

Why this collaboration stands out

The collection lands on April 23 alongside Westside Whimsy, and that timing matters because the jewelry is designed as an accompaniment to the album rather than a side project. Hypebae describes the capsule as rooted in nature, mysticism, and femininity through Aiko’s Californian lens, with iridescent finishes and vibrant stones leading the story. That combination makes the line especially appealing for anyone who wants jewelry that feels symbolic, feminine, and a little dreamlike without tipping into costume territory.

The details are what make the pieces giftable. The Aquamarine ALLEL Coin is said to represent clarity and ease, which gives it an especially good case as a gift for someone in transition, starting something new, or simply needing a gentler daily reminder. The Califia Goddess Pendant reaches back to California myth through Califia, a figure tied to sovereignty and sanctuary, while sabertooth tiger-engraved pendants push the guardian theme into something more primal and protective.

Why Awe Inspired gives the collaboration credibility

Awe Inspired is not treating this as a novelty drop. The brand says it has more than 25,000 five-star reviews, and its core identity centers on fine jewelry as a vehicle for empowerment, with pieces designed by hand and made ethically. Its broader aesthetic is built around the natural world, sacred symbols, and what it calls the mysteries of the dark feminine, which makes Aiko’s mythic, feminine, nature-led worldview feel like a natural extension rather than a mismatch.

That matters when you are deciding whether a piece is worth giving. Awe Inspired’s own assortment shows a broad luxury range, from an ear cuff at $95 and signet rings around $195 to gemstone pieces at $365 and higher-end pendants that climb far beyond that, so the collaboration sits in a polished, giftable fine-jewelry lane rather than a trinket category.
